Job Description – Wayleave Engineer / Site Engineer

Location: Site-based (UK-wide travel required)
Reports to: Site and Project Managers
Employment Type: Full-time, Permanent

Overview

We are seeking a proactive and adaptable Wayleave Engineer / Site Engineer to join our team delivering overhead line (OHL) transmission schemes across the UK. This dual-role combines wayleave and access negotiation with hands-on site engineering responsibilities, providing critical support in enabling and executing high-voltage construction works.

Key Responsibilities
Wayleave / Access Engineering
  • Engage with landowners, tenants, agents, local authorities, and statutory bodies to secure necessary wayleave agreements, access rights, and consents.

  • Conduct site visits and assessments to identify access constraints, environmental sensitivities, and land use impacts.

  • Support resolution of landowner concerns, disputes, and compensation discussions in coordination with client Wayleave Officers.

  • Maintain accurate records of wayleave status, correspondence, access agreements, and engagement logs.

  • Liaise with the client’s wayleave, legal, and environmental teams to ensure alignment with scheme requirements.

  • Contribute to access strategy development and route planning from a construction logistics perspective.

Site Engineering Support
  • Assist Site and Project Managers and project teams in the delivery of construction works, including surveys, setting out, and quality assurance.

  • Provide technical support to construction teams during piling, tower erection, stringing, and commissioning phases.

  • Monitor site progress, prepare method statements and risk assessments, and assist in producing as-built records.

  • Ensure compliance with HSEQ standards, environmental constraints, and temporary works requirements.

  • Coordinate with subcontractors, suppliers, and utility companies on-site.

Key Skills & Experience
  • Proven experience in either wayleave/access negotiation or civil/site engineering within utilities, power transmission, or infrastructure sectors.

  • Strong interpersonal and negotiation skills, capable of engaging with a wide range of stakeholders.

  • Working knowledge of UK legislation related to land access, planning, and environmental consents.

  • Good understanding of OHL construction techniques and sequencing (132kV – 400kV preferred).

  • Competency in reading technical drawings, maps, and land registry plans.

  • CSCS card and full UK driving licence required.

Desirable Qualifications
  • Degree or HNC in Civil Engineering, Land Management, Environmental Management, or a related field.

  • Experience with GIS or CAD software.

  • National Grid Person / BESC / Person Competent (desirable; training can be provided).

  • Familiarity with National Grid TGN and TP documents or other DNO/TO standards.
